Abstract
A system comprises a guide wire, an embolic protection basket carried on the guide wire, and a catheter carried on the guide wire adjacent the embolic protection basket. The catheter includes an elongated carrier and a balloon about the carrier in sealed relation thereto. The balloon is arranged to receive a fluid therein that inflates the balloon, and an arc generator including at least one electrode within the balloon forms a mechanical shock wave within the balloon.

11. A method comprising:
-
providing a guide wire; inserting the guide wire into a vessel of interest of a patient; providing an embolic protection basket; advancing the embolic protection basket along the guide wire within the vessel; providing a catheter including an elongated carrier, a balloon about the carrier in sealed relation thereto, the balloon being arranged to receive a fluid therein that inflates the balloon, and agenerator within the balloon that forms a mechanical shock wave within the balloon; guiding the catheter into the vessel of the patient to a position adjacent to and up stream from the embolic protection basket; admitting fluid into the balloon; and causing the generator to form a series of mechanical shocks within the balloon. - View Dependent Claims (14)
